Garden Border Replacement in Citrus County, FL
Garden border replacement services involve updating or restoring the edging that defines garden beds, pathways, and landscaped areas. This service covers a variety of projects, including replacing worn or damaged borders made from materials such as brick, stone, plastic, or metal. Property owners often seek this service to improve the appearance of their landscape, contain mulch or soil, and create a clean separation between different areas of their yard. Before requesting border replacement, homeowners typically want to understand the types of materials available, the durability of different options, and how the new borders will complement their existing landscaping.
Property owners considering garden border replacement should also consider the scope of the project, including the size and shape of the areas to be bordered, as well as any specific design preferences. It’s useful to clarify whether the existing borders need removal or if the new borders will be installed over the current ones. Additionally, understanding maintenance requirements and how the new borders will withstand local weather conditions can help in making an informed decision. Proper planning ensures the finished landscape maintains both functionality and visual appeal.

Common Garden Border Replacement Jobs
Garden border replacement involves updating or removing outdated or damaged edging to refresh landscape aesthetics.
Plant bed borders help define planting areas and prevent soil and mulch from spilling into walkways.
Decorative edging adds visual interest and complements the overall landscape design.
Retaining wall borders provide structure and support for sloped or uneven garden areas.
Pathway borders enhance walkway safety and create a neat, finished appearance.
Custom border solutions are available to suit specific landscape styles and property needs.
Garden Border Replacement Questions
What types of materials are used for garden border replacement? Common options include brick, stone, wood, and plastic, chosen to complement the landscape and withstand local weather conditions.
When should garden borders be replaced? Replacement is recommended when borders are damaged, shifted, or no longer match the desired garden design.
Can garden border replacement help improve curb appeal? Yes, replacing worn or outdated borders can refresh the appearance of a garden and enhance overall property aesthetics.
What factors influence the choice of garden border design? Consider the existing landscape style, maintenance preferences, and the durability needed for the border material.
